
在JavaScript中,实现多行注释的方法有两种:使用/*...*/包裹注释内容、使用多个单行注释//。 在JavaScript中,多行注释的常见方式是使用/*...*/包裹注释内容。这种方式不仅简单明了,而且非常适合注释大段代码或详细的文档说明。使用多个单行注释//虽然也可以实现多行注释,但在长段文本中可能显得冗长且不够直观。
使用/*...*/包裹注释内容是JavaScript中最常见和推荐的方式。通过这种方式,可以轻松地注释掉大段代码或添加详细的文档说明,而不影响代码的可读性和维护性。例如:
/*
这是一个多行注释的例子。
可以在这里写很多行注释。
这种方式非常适合注释大段代码或详细的文档说明。
*/
接下来,我们将详细探讨JavaScript中实现多行注释的方法、最佳实践及其应用场景。
一、使用/*...*/实现多行注释
1.1、基础用法
多行注释的基础用法非常简单,只需在注释内容的开始和结束处分别添加/*和*/即可。这种方式可以包裹任意数量的代码行或文本行。
/*
这是一个多行注释的示例。
你可以在这里添加任意数量的注释内容。
*/
1.2、注释大段代码
在开发过程中,有时需要临时注释掉大段代码以便进行调试或测试。使用/*...*/可以非常方便地实现这一目的。
/*
if (condition) {
// 这段代码将被注释掉,不会执行
console.log('This will not be printed.');
}
*/
1.3、详细文档说明
多行注释也常用于详细的文档说明,如函数的参数、返回值及其用途。这有助于提高代码的可读性和维护性。
/*
函数名称:add
参数:
- a: 第一个加数
- b: 第二个加数
返回值:两个加数的和
用途:计算两个数的和,并返回结果
*/
function add(a, b) {
return a + b;
}
二、使用多个单行注释实现多行注释
2.1、基础用法
除了使用/*...*/,还可以使用多个单行注释//来实现多行注释。这种方式虽然也能达到注释多行的效果,但在长段文本中可能显得冗长。
// 这是一个多行注释的示例。
// 你可以在这里添加任意数量的注释内容。
// 但是每行都需要添加一个`//`。
2.2、注释大段代码
使用多个单行注释也可以注释掉大段代码,但这种方式在实际应用中并不常见,因为代码看起来会比较杂乱。
// if (condition) {
// // 这段代码将被注释掉,不会执行
// console.log('This will not be printed.');
// }
2.3、详细文档说明
尽管多个单行注释也可以用于详细的文档说明,但这种方式不如/*...*/直观和简洁。
// 函数名称:add
// 参数:
// - a: 第一个加数
// - b: 第二个加数
// 返回值:两个加数的和
// 用途:计算两个数的和,并返回结果
function add(a, b) {
return a + b;
}
三、最佳实践
3.1、选择合适的注释方式
在选择注释方式时,应根据具体的应用场景选择合适的注释方式。对于大段代码或详细的文档说明,推荐使用/*...*/;对于简短的注释,可以使用单行注释//。
3.2、注释内容要简洁明了
无论使用哪种注释方式,注释内容都应简洁明了,尽量避免冗长和复杂的描述。注释的目的是帮助理解代码,而不是增加阅读负担。
3.3、定期更新注释
代码在不断变化,注释也应随之更新。定期检查和更新注释,确保其与代码保持一致,可以提高代码的可维护性。
四、实际应用场景
4.1、注释调试代码
在开发过程中,常常需要临时注释掉某些代码进行调试。使用/*...*/可以方便地注释掉大段代码,而不影响其他部分的执行。
/*
function complexCalculation() {
// 复杂的计算过程
return result;
}
*/
4.2、文档化复杂函数
对于复杂的函数,详细的文档说明可以帮助其他开发者快速理解函数的用途和使用方法。使用/*...*/可以方便地添加详细的文档说明。
/*
函数名称:calculate
参数:
- x: 输入值
- y: 输入值
返回值:计算结果
用途:执行复杂的计算过程,并返回结果
*/
function calculate(x, y) {
// 复杂的计算过程
return result;
}
4.3、分隔代码块
在长篇代码中,可以使用多行注释分隔不同的代码块,以提高代码的可读性。例如,可以在每个模块的开头添加多行注释,说明模块的功能和用途。
/*
模块名称:用户管理
功能:处理用户的增删改查操作
*/
function addUser(user) {
// 添加用户
}
function deleteUser(userId) {
// 删除用户
}
五、总结
JavaScript中实现多行注释的主要方法有两种:使用/*...*/包裹注释内容、使用多个单行注释//。其中,使用/*...*/是最常见和推荐的方式,适合注释大段代码和详细的文档说明。而使用多个单行注释//虽然也可以实现多行注释,但在长段文本中显得不够直观和简洁。
在实际应用中,应根据具体的场景选择合适的注释方式,确保注释内容简洁明了,并定期更新注释,以保持其与代码的一致性。通过合理使用多行注释,可以提高代码的可读性和可维护性,为团队协作和项目管理提供有力支持。
如果在项目管理过程中需要使用项目团队管理系统,推荐使用研发项目管理系统PingCode和通用项目协作软件Worktile。这两个系统可以帮助团队更好地管理项目,提高工作效率。
总之,合理使用多行注释是编写高质量JavaScript代码的重要一环。通过掌握和应用这些技巧,可以使代码更加清晰、易懂,为团队协作和项目管理打下良好的基础。
相关问答FAQs:
Q: 如何在JavaScript中实现多行注释?
A: JavaScript中实现多行注释非常简单,您只需要将要注释的代码包裹在/和/之间即可。
Q: JavaScript中的多行注释有什么作用?
A: 多行注释在JavaScript中被用于注释掉一段代码,这样代码就不会被执行。它可以用于临时禁用一段代码或者添加注释以便其他开发人员理解代码的用途。
Q: 多行注释和单行注释有什么区别?
A: 多行注释和单行注释在注释的范围上有所不同。多行注释可以注释多行代码,而单行注释只能注释一行代码。此外,多行注释可以嵌套在单行注释中,但是单行注释无法嵌套。
Q: JavaScript中多行注释的使用场景有哪些?
A: 多行注释在以下几种情况下非常有用:
- 当您想禁用一段代码时,可以使用多行注释将其注释掉。
- 当您想向其他开发人员解释代码的用途或者实现细节时,可以在代码旁边添加多行注释。
- 当您想测试不同的代码变体时,可以使用多行注释来暂时屏蔽一部分代码。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2281638